Perseverance Pays Poem
Appropriate for Individual and Group Settings.
- Download and enlarge to create a poster. Glue to cardboard backing.
- Download, place blank white paper over the 17 lines of the poem, leaving the title and the rainbow artwork visible. Make copies for later use.
- Announce that you have a special poem to share about perseverance.
- Ask if anyone knows what it is. Instruct kid(s) to get quiet and listen.
- Read title and poem aloud. Ask again what is perseverance.
- Ask if anyone present has ever felt like giving up. When? Why?
- Ask if anyone has ever shown perseverance. Applause for answers.
- Distribute copies made earlier and instruct kid(s) to write a poem or paragraph about how they did or would like to show perseverance.
- Invite volunteers to read their writing aloud. Display their work.

I’m Flying High with Ambitions!
- Make copies needed.
- Introduce activity by announcing that you’d like to fly to the moon!
- After the laughter at this attention-getter, say, "Well, it's an ambition!"
- Ask what the word ambition means. Discuss age-appropriately.
- Announce that you have an activity to fly high with ambition.
- Distribute and review activity page.
- Instruct child/children to complete the sentences and color the balloons.
- Spend extra time talking about "liking being me," to build self-confidence.
